Shenandoah, Miami,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Shenandoah?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Shenandoah Studio Apartments | $1,640 | $1,099 | $2,391 |
| Shenandoah 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,239 | $1,450 | $3,265 |
| Shenandoah 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,937 | $1,690 | $5,179 |
| Shenandoah 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,228 | $2,600 | $7,300 |
| Shenandoah 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,042 | $4,500 | $6,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Shenandoah Apartments with Swimming Pool
What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in Shenandoah?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Shenandoah with Swimming Pool is at Gibraltar Apartments listed at $1,750.
How much is the average rent for Shenandoah Apartments with Swimming Pool?
The average rent for a Apartment in Shenandoah with Swimming Pool is $3,567.
What is the largest Shenandoah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?
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in Shenandoah is a 1,747 square feet unit starting from $2,549 at Grove Station Tower.
What is the average size for Shenandoah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?
The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in Shenandoah is currently at 868 sq ft.
